Subject: Cut-over done — Glimmer handlers now on the warm pool

Hi on-call,

Quick recap: we finished the cut-over of the Glimmer serverless handlers last night. Cold starts were the whole reason for this, and early numbers look good — p99 init time dropped sharply once the warm pool kicked in. Traffic is fully shifted; the old stack stays up for a week as a fallback. If latency spikes, check pool sizing first. The handlers launched with the settings below.

config for kafof-bawef:
holath:
  log_level: debug
  metrics_host: metrics.holath.qorvelsys.internal
  pin: 2191
  pool_size: 32

14:22 — Spoolhaven queue depth alerted on the Merridock cluster. 14:29 — Priya rolled back the duplex-render patch; depth kept climbing. 14:41 — Found stale lease in the spooler's claim table blocking all workers. 14:47 — Lease force-expired, backlog drained in nine minutes. No jobs lost. Root cause owned by the Fenwick team. The canary build that introduced the lease bug is recorded below.

trace token, fafog-kageg: htk4_98e6

Subject: Ledgerloop reconciliation job — this week's release

Team,

The inventory reconciliation job for the Harwick warehouse cluster ships Thursday. Changes: mismatch tolerance drops from 2% to 0.5%, and partial shipments now reconcile against the staging ledger instead of the live one. Expect a longer first run while historical deltas backfill. No action needed unless the sync dashboard flags drift. For the release notes, reference the build token below.

session token of tajef-bageg = htk21_5d90d574934f3ccae6437

Ticket: Locked vault is blocking Squatwatch updates. Hey plugin folks — the Squatwatch typo-squatting scanner can't pull its rule bundle because the Kestrel vault locked itself after last night's failed rotation. Until it's open, new package-name checks won't run, so hold off publishing. To unlock, the on-duty maintainer enters the recovery passphrase at the vault prompt. For the record, it's:

recovery phrase for fafof-kagaf: eliath-zormir